Canon G16 vs Nikon D60
The Canon PowerShot G16 and the Nikon D60 are two digital cameras that were announced, respectively, in August 2013 and January 2008. The G16 is a fixed lens compact, while the D60 is a DSLR. The cameras are based on a 1/1.7-inch (G16) and an APS-C (D60) sensor. The Canon has a resolution of 12 megapixels, whereas the Nikon provides 10 MP.

Body comparison
An illustration of the physical size and weight of the Canon G16 and the Nikon D60 is provided in the side-by-side display below. The two cameras are presented according to their relative size. Three consecutive perspectives from the front, the top, and the back are available. All size dimensions are rounded to the nearest millimeter.
If the front view area (width x height) of the cameras is taken as an aggregate measure of their size, the Nikon D60 is considerably larger (43 percent) than the Canon G16. In this context, it is worth noting that neither the G16 nor the D60 are weather-sealed.
The above size and weight comparisons are to some extent incomplete and possibly misleading, as the G16 has a lens built in, whereas the D60 is an interchangeable lens camera that requires a separate lens. Attaching the latter will add extra weight and bulk to the setup. You can compare the optics available for the D60 and their specifications in the Nikon Lens Catalog.
Concerning battery life, the G16 gets 360 shots out of its Canon NB-10L battery, while the D60 can take 500 images on a single charge of its Nikon EN-EL9 power pack.

Sensor comparison
The size of the sensor inside a digital camera is one of the key determinants of image quality. A large sensor will generally have larger individual pixels that offer better low-light sensitivity, provide wider dynamic range, and have richer color-depth than smaller pixels in a sensor of the same technological generation. Further, a large sensor camera will give the photographer additional creative options when using shallow depth-of-field to isolate a subject from its background. On the downside, larger sensors are more costly to manufacture and tend to lead to bigger and heavier cameras and lenses.
Of the two cameras under consideration, the Canon G16 features a 1/1.7-inch sensor and the Nikon D60 an APS-C sensor. The sensor area in the D60 is 788 percent bigger. As a result of these sensor size differences, the cameras have a format factor of, respectively, 4.65 and 1.5. The sensor in the G16 has a native 4:3 aspect ratio, while the one in the D60 offers a 3:2 aspect.
Despite having a smaller sensor, the Canon G16 offers a higher resolution of 12 megapixels, compared with 10 MP of the Nikon D60. This megapixels advantage comes at the cost of a higher pixel density and a smaller size of the individual pixel (with a pixel pitch of 1.87μm versus 6.11μm for the D60). However, it should be noted that the G16 is much more recent (by 5 years and 6 months) than the D60, and its sensor will have benefitted from technological advances during this time that make it possible to gather light more efficiently.
The resolution advantage of the Canon G16 implies greater flexibility for cropping images or the possibility to print larger pictures. The maximum print size of the G16 for good quality output (200 dots per inch) amounts to 20 x 15 inches or 50.8 x 38.1 cm, for very good quality (250 dpi) 16 x 12 inches or 40.6 x 30.5 cm, and for excellent quality (300 dpi) 13.3 x 10 inches or 33.9 x 25.4 cm. The corresponding values for the Nikon D60 are 19.4 x 13 inches or 49.2 x 32.9 cm for good quality, 15.5 x 10.4 inches or 39.3 x 26.3 cm for very good quality, and 12.9 x 8.6 inches or 32.8 x 21.9 cm for excellent quality prints.
The Canon PowerShot G16 has a native sensitivity range from ISO 80 to ISO 12800. The corresponding ISO settings for the Nikon D60 are ISO 100 to ISO 1600, with the possibility to increase the ISO range to 100-3200.
In terms of underlying technology, the G16 is build around a BSI-CMOS sensor, while the D60 uses a CCD imager. Both cameras use a Bayer filter for capturing RGB colors on a square grid of photosensors. This arrangement is found in most digital cameras.
For many cameras, data on sensor performance has been reported by DXO Mark. This service is based on lab testing and assigns an overall score to each camera sensor, as well as ratings for dynamic range ("DXO Landscape"), color depth ("DXO Portrait"), and low-light sensitivity ("DXO Sports"). Of the two cameras under consideration, the D60 offers substantially better image quality than the G16 (overall score 11 points higher). The advantage is based on 1.5 bits higher color depth, 0.3 EV of lower dynamic range, and 1.3 stops in additional low light sensitivity. Many modern cameras are not only capable of taking still images, but can also record movies. The G16 indeed provides movie recording capabilities, while the D60 does not. The highest resolution format that the G16 can use is 1080/60p.
Feature comparison
Apart from body and sensor, cameras can and do differ across a range of features. The G16 and the D60 are similar in the sense that both have an optical viewfinder. The latter is useful for getting a clear image for framing even in brightly lit environments. The Canon G16 has an intervalometer built-in. This enables the photographer to capture time lapse sequences, such as flower blooming, a sunset or moon rise, without purchasing an external camera trigger and related software.
The G16 writes its imaging data to SDXC cards, while the D60 uses SDHC cards. The G16 supports UHS-I cards (Ultra High Speed data transfer of up to 104 MB/s), while the D60 cannot take advantage of Ultra High Speed SD cards.

It is notable that the G16 offers wifi support, while the D60 does not. Wifi can be a very convenient means to transfer image data to an off-camera location.
Both the G16 and the D60 have been discontinued, but can regularly be found used on ebay. The D60 was replaced by the Nikon D5000, while the G16 does not have a direct successor. Review summary
So what conclusions can be drawn? Is there a clear favorite between the Canon G16 and the Nikon D60? Which camera is better? A synthesis of the relative strong points of each of the models is listed below.
Advantages of the Canon PowerShot G16:
- More detail: Offers more megapixels (12 vs 10MP) with a 7% higher linear resolution.
- Broader imaging potential: Can record not only still images but also 1080/60p movies.
- Larger screen: Has a bigger rear LCD (3.0" vs 2.5") for image review and settings control.
- More detailed LCD: Has a higher resolution rear screen (922k vs 230k dots).
- Easier time-lapse photography: Has an intervalometer built-in for low frequency shooting.
- Ready to shoot: Comes with a built-in lens, while the D60 requires a separate lens.
- More compact: Is smaller (109x76mm vs 126x94mm) and thus needs less room in the bag.
- Less heavy: Is lighter even though it comes with a built-in lens (unlike the D60).
- Sharper images: Has hand-shake reducing image stabilization built-in.
- Easier file upload: Has wifi built in for automatic backup or image transfer to the web.
- Faster buffer clearing: Has an SD card interface that supports the UHS-I standard.
- More affordable: Was introduced at a lower price, despite coming with a built-in lens.
- More modern: Reflects 5 years and 6 months of technical progress since the D60 launch.
Arguments in favor of the Nikon D60:
- Better image quality: Scores substantially higher (11 points) in the DXO overall evaluation.
- Richer colors: Generates noticeably more natural colors (1.5 bits more color depth).
- Better low-light sensitivity: Can shoot in dim conditions (1.3 stops ISO advantage).
- Faster burst: Shoots at higher frequency (3 vs 2.2 flaps/sec) to capture the decisive moment.
- More flexible: Makes it possible to change lenses and thus to use specialty optics.
- Longer lasting: Gets more shots (500 versus 360) out of a single battery charge.
- More heavily discounted: Has been around for much longer (launched in January 2008).
If the count of relative strengths (bullet points above) is taken as a measure, the G16 is the clear winner of the match-up (13 : 7 points). However, the relative importance of the various individual camera aspects will vary according to personal preferences and needs, so that you might like to apply corresponding weights to the particular features before making a decision on a new camera. A professional wildlife photographer will view the differences between cameras in a way that diverges from the perspective of a family photog, and a person interested in architecture has distinct needs from a sports shooter. Hence, the decision which camera is best and worth buying is often a very personal one.
